ABSTRACT
Efficient goods procurement is critical for organizational performance, cost-effectiveness, and supply chain reliability. In recent years, supplier evaluation systems have become essential tools for assessing vendor capability, quality, price competitiveness, delivery performance, and compliance with organizational and regulatory requirements. This study examines the role of supplier evaluation systems in improving goods procurement outcomes across public and private sector organizations. The study investigates how systematic supplier evaluation influences procurement efficiency, product quality, cost reduction, risk mitigation, and supplier relationship management. A descriptive research design was adopted, and data were collected through structured questionnaires administered to procurement officers, supply chain managers, and purchasing personnel. The findings reveal that organizations that implement structured supplier evaluation systems record significantly improved procurement performance, reduced lead times, enhanced product quality, and better decision-making in supplier selection. The study concludes that supplier evaluation systems are crucial for ensuring transparency, accountability, and overall effectiveness in procurement processes. It recommends that organizations adopt standardized evaluation criteria, utilize digital procurement tools, and conduct continuous performance monitoring to strengthen supply chain outcomes and achieve sustainable procurement efficiency.
